Crema's Take
“Spruce Cafe captures that coveted neighborhood gem feeling with genuinely warm staff and a cozy, authentic local vibe that keeps people lingering over breakfast. Their fluffy pancakes and excellent bagel and lox stand out when executed well, though consistency seems to be their challenge—some visits deliver an 8/10 experience while others fall flat with rushed service and subpar ingredients. If you catch them on a good day with attentive service, it's the kind of laptop-friendly spot where you'll want to become a regular.”
